كورسات بايثون مجانية للمبتدئين: دليلك الشامل للتعلم والتطبيق 2025

كورسات بايثون مجانية للمبتدئين

كورسات بايثون مجانية للمبتدئين: دليلك الشامل للتعلم والتطبيق

في هذا الدليل ، ستجدون عرضاً مفصّلاً لأهم كورسات بايثون مجانية للمبتدئين، إلى جانب مشاريع عملية ونصائح للتطبيق العملي. سواء كنتم تهدفون للدخول في مجال البرمجة أو علم البيانات أو التعلم الآلي، ستوفر لكم هذه الموارد أساساً متيناً وانطلاقة قوية.

لماذا تتعلم لغة Python؟

تُعَدّ بايثون من أسرع اللغات نمواً وشعبية في العالم التقني، لما تتمتع به من مزايا:

  • سهولة التعلم: تركيب لغوي واضح وسلس للمبتدئين.
  • تعدد المجالات: تستخدم في تطوير الويب، علم البيانات، الأتمتة، والتعلم الآلي.
  • مجتمع كبير: مكتبات مفتوحة المصدر ودعم مستمر من المطورين.
  • فرص عمل مميزة: طلب متزايد على مبرمجي بايثون في السوق العالمي.
  • مشاريع عملية: تطبيقات حقيقية وأدوات تساعدك على بناء محفظة عمل قوية.

يمكنك أيضا الاطلاع على : كورسات فوتوشوب مجانية معتمدة

أفضل كورسات بايثون المجانية

إليكم مجموعة من أشهر الموارد المجانية التي تمنحكم مساراً تعليمياً متكاملاً من الصفر حتى الاحتراف:

1. كورس راكوان للبرمجة

  • المدة: 6 ساعات تدريبية مركزة.
  • المشاريع العملية: 37 مشروعاً تطبيقيّاً.
  • المزايا: خالٍ من التعقيدات النظرية، عملي بالكامل، مجاني 100%.
  • المخرجات: فهم أساسيات بايثون، التفكير كمبرمج محترف، إنشاء سكربتات وأدوات، اكتساب الثقة لبناء برامج خاصة.

2. كورس GeeksforGeeks المجاني

  • نوع الكورس: ذاتي الإيقاع (Self-Paced).
  • المحتوى: من الأساسيات إلى المواضيع المتقدمة مثل البرمجة الكائنية وهياكل البيانات.
  • الشهادة: شهادة معتمدة بعد اجتياز الاختبارات النهائية للكورس.
  • المزايا: مناسب للمبتدئين والمحترفين، يشمل معالجة البيانات وإنشاء واجهات برمجية API.

يمكنك أيضا الاطلاع على : كورسات ICDL مجانية معتمدة

3. موارد إضافية لتعلم Python مجاناً

بجانب الدورات السابقة، يمكنكم الاستفادة من:

  • موقع Mimo لتعلم Python بخطوات يومية قصيرة.
  • موقع Rivery الذي يجمع أفضل المصادر المجانية والكتب الإلكترونية.
  • كتاب “Python عن طريق الأمثلة” المجاني على د.لارابي.
  • وثائق جديدة ومختصرة على Scribd.

مشاريع بايثون للمبتدئين

الانتقال من النظرية إلى التطبيق خطوة حاسمة. هذه بعض الأفكار لتنمية مهاراتك:

  1. آلة حاسبة بسيطة: إنشاء واجهة إدخال الأرقام وتنفيذ العمليات الحسابية.
  2. سلسلة فيبوناتشي: طباعة الأعداد وتخزين النتائج في قائمة.
  3. مدقق قوة كلمة المرور: برنامج يحلل طول وتعقيد الكلمات ويقترح تحسينات.
  4. مفكرة إلكترونية: تخزين الملاحظات والمهام اليومية في ملف نصّي.
  5. تطبيق ويب صغير: باستخدام إطار عمل Flask لعرض بيانات بسيطة على المتصفح.

خدمات أكاديمية متميزة من تروسكو

تقدم تروسكو مجموعة واسعة من الحلول التعليمية: دورات تمهيدية متخصصة، استشارات دراسية، ودورات متقدمة لجميع المستويات، مع تقييمات عملاء إيجابية ومستوى دعم احترافي.

استعرض الخدمات

نصائح لزيادة الفائدة من التعلم

  • التعلم المنتظم: خصص وقتاً يومياً أو أسبوعياً للتمارين العملية.
  • قراءة الوثائق الرسمية: وثائق Python الرسمية عبر موقع python.org.
  • المشاركة في المجتمعات: مثل Stack Overflow، وGitHub، وReddit.
  • المساهمة في مشاريع مفتوحة المصدر: فرصة للتعلم من الشفرة الحقيقية والتعاون مع مطورين آخرين.
  • توثيق ما تتعلمه: اكتب مقالات قصيرة أو تدوينات حول تجاربك ومشاريعك.

يمكنك أيضا الاطلاع على : كورسات هارفارد المجانية

أسئلة شائعة

ما هي أهمية تعلم Python؟

Python لغة مرنة وسهلة التعامل، وتفتح مجالات واسعة في البرمجة وتعلم الآلة وتحليل البيانات، مما يجعلها اختياراً مثالياً للمبتدئين والمحترفين على حد سواء.

كيف أبدأ رحلتي في تعلم Python؟

1. اختر دورة مجانية مثل كورس راكوان أو GeeksforGeeks.
2. قم بالتطبيق العملي فوراً على مشاريع صغيرة.
3. استفد من المصادر الإضافية وحضور الندوات المجانية إن وجدت.

ما هي المشاريع المناسبة بعد إتقان الأساسيات؟

يمكنك بناء روبوت دردشة بسيط، أو تحليل بيانات حقيقية باستخدام مكتبات Pandas وMatplotlib، أو تطوير تطبيق ويب بسيط باستخدام Flask أو Django.

الخلاصة

تعلّم بايثون من الصفر عبر كورسات مجانية وتطبيقات عملية يضمن لك اكتساب مهارات مطلوبة في السوق. احرص على الموازنة بين الجانب النظري والتطبيقي، واستعن بالمجتمعات التقنية لتبادل الخبرات. ابدأ اليوم واستفد من المصادر المرفقة لتحقيق تقدم واضح في مسيرتك البرمجية.

 

السابق
كورسات تصميم مواقع مجانية 2025
التالي
كورسات LinkedIn Learning المجانية في 2025: دليلك الشامل

اترك تعليقاً